Although it lands on a different day each year according to the Gregorian calendar, Chinese New Year a/k/a Lunar New Year, or Spring Festival, according to Wikipedia, is the first day of the first month of the Chinese calendar.
4703, or 2006, if you prefer, is the Year of the Dog. To learn more about how wonderful Dog people are, and to find out your Chinese zodiac sign, check out this site: http://www.rainfall.com/horoscop/chinese.htm.
